A study was made to determine biological relationships between the garden symphylan, Scutigerella immaculata (Newport), and an entomogenous fungus, Entomophthora coronata (Costantin), which attacks it under certain conditions. Laser ultrasonics can be used to nondestructively evaluate structures to determine the existence and location of surface and interior flaws.
